The Scranton Cultural Center at the Masonic Temple presents Meredith Willson's classic musical comedy, The Music Man. This beloved production follows the story of Harold Hill, a traveling salesman who cons the people of River City. With iconic songs and a heartwarming narrative, the show is a staple of American musical theater.
